His Highness Sheikh Dr. Sultan bin Mohammed Al Qassimi, Member of the Supreme Council and Ruler of Sharjah, inaugurated yesterday the Crown Tower of Qasimiyah University, Sheikh Sultan bin Mohammed bin Sultan Al Qasimi, Crown Prince of Sharjah, A donation from Sharjah Islamic Bank and a contribution from the Sharjah Electricity and Water Authority (SEWA), which ensures free delivery of electricity and water services. The launch comes within the framework of the Bank's social responsibility and commitment to supporting community and endowment initiatives in Sharjah and the UAE.

His Highness the Ruler of Sharjah inspected the tower, which covers an area of ​​40,568 square meters. It consists of 31 residential floors. It includes 186 apartments divided equally between the three-bedroom apartments, the four-bedroom apartments, the ground floor and six dedicated floors Such as car parks, a capacity of 178 cars, and four shops.

He also witnessed the facilities of the tower, which has a beautiful design in the entrance hall, with a seating area for visitors, a waiting area for apartment owners and high quality finishes. The apartments are characterized by good spaces, high quality and consistent designs. The tower includes recreational and recreational facilities such as swimming pool, children's playroom and multi-purpose hall. Sharjah Islamic Bank Chairman, Abdulrahman bin Mohammed Al Owais, confirmed that the tower is the fourth of the Waqf towers. The bank has already suspended a residential tower to support students of science and research at Sharjah University and another tower of Sharjah Social Services Department and a tower to support the Sharjah Foundation for Social Empowerment. The inauguration of the new tower is a continuation of the bank's approach to serving the community and achieving the government's vision of strengthening the national spirit and commitment to Emirati values ​​in giving and good.

He pointed out that the tower, which was implemented by Asas Real Estate Company, the real estate arm of the bank, will allocate its full proceeds to support the Qassimia University and meet the needs of its students coming from within the UAE and other countries in line with the directives of His Highness Sheikh Dr. Sultan bin Mohammed Al Qassimi.
